About SchoolMessenger
App Features:
- Easy-to-read inbox that captures all SchoolMessenger notifications, and now two-way teacher-parent-student messages (if enabled by school or district)
- Scrollable notification view to review all phone, email, and text content in a single place
- Detailed preference control allows adjusting notification settings
- Push notifications are available for alerts when school or district sends a message
Requirements:
- For notifications, school or district has SchoolMessenger notification service subscription with SchoolMessenger app enabled
- For notifications, valid email address on file with your school or district
- WiFi or data plan for internet access
- iOS 14+
Note:
SchoolMessenger app is not for sending broadcast messages. If you are a SchoolMessenger Communicate notification customer looking to send broadcast messages, please download the SchoolMessenger Admin sender app.
